Abstract
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ui pengaruh positif self-disclosure terhadap relationship satisfaction pada dewasa awal yang sedang menjalani hubungan romantis. Penelitian ini menggunakan metode kuantitatif dengan teknik pengambilan sampel purposive sampling. Sampel yang digunakan dalam penelitian ini sebanyak 314 responden dengan rentang usia 18–40 tahun dengan durasi hubungan romantis minimal 6 bulan. Instrumen yang digunakan adalah Revised Self-disclosure Scale (RSDS) oleh Wheeless (1978) dan Relationship Assessment Scale (RAS) oleh Hendrick (1988). Uji hipotesis yang digunakan adalah analisis regresi berganda. Hasil penelitian ini menunjukkan bahwa terdapat pengaruh positif self-disclosure terhadap relationship satisfaction pada dewasa awal yang sedang menjalani hubungan romantis yang signifikan (p<0,05). This study uses a quantitative method with a purposive sampling technique. The sample used in this study was 314 respondents aged 18–40 years with a minimum romantic relationship duration of 6 months. The instruments used were the Revised Self-disclosure Scale (RSDS) by Wheeless (1978) and the Relationship Assessment Scale (RAS) by Hendrick (1988). The hypothesis test used was multiple regression analysis. The results of this study indicate that there is a positive influence of self-disclosure on relationship satisfaction in young adults who are in a romantic relationship which is significant (p <0.05). The R square value shows that self-disclosure contributes 15.4% in influencing relationship satisfaction.
